Analysis of Trump’s Praise for U.S. Action in Ukraine
President Donald Trump’s recent remarks on U.S. military assistance to Ukraine highlight a significant point: the unparalleled capabilities of the United States in projecting power and building alliances. “There’s no other country on Earth that can do such a maneuver,” he stated, praising the extensive support operation aimed at countering Russian aggression. This claim is grounded in the reality of America’s longstanding military infrastructure and international partnerships developed over decades.
The sheer scale of U.S. military aid since Russia’s invasion in February 2022—totaling over $66 billion—demonstrates the sustained commitment from Washington. This contribution includes advanced weapon systems and training programs, showcasing not just a reactive posture but proactive planning aimed at fostering a robust Ukrainian defense. Trump’s approval reflects confidence in this effort, which has become one of the largest military logistics operations since World War II.
Moreover, the U.S. role extends beyond mere military support. It involves complex diplomatic maneuvers, such as facilitating Third Party Transfers where NATO allies send U.S.-origin equipment to Ukraine. The introduction of systems like Patriot missiles and HIMARS rocket launchers has had a strategic impact, complicating Russian military operations in the field. This tactical shift underscores the significant influence the U.S. wields in international military affairs.

The ongoing war in Ukraine is not merely a military campaign; it represents a profound humanitarian crisis. Approximately 160,000 square kilometers of Ukrainian territory are contaminated with landmines, posing significant challenges to rehabilitation efforts. The U.S. has recognized this, rolling out comprehensive humanitarian assistance and demining initiatives. The collaboration between American contractors and Ukrainian forces illustrates the deepening commitment to not only win the war but ensure a return to normalcy in the aftermath.
